My meeting of creditors is/was today I received an email yesterday saying that they will contact me today to let me know the outcome... I haven't heard anything yet so i went to credit fix online chat...they have said it may take a couple of days but it's making me think that it getting rejected.

Re: Worried.
Posted: Thu Mar 22, 2018 5:20 pm
by Foggy
I am afraid that this is normal for Creditfix ... they do not "do" communication at all well ( -- or even "at all") . Sometimes they are just tardy in getting back to you, other times they are chasing votes ( but it does not occur to them that you need to know this! ). You have to keep on their backs to get any meaningful information.

Try not to worry too much just yet. I’m with Payplan and I needed to have a second creditors meeting to add quite a large loan that was now unsecured halfway through my IVA. Was quite nerve racking as I was asking for another £17K to be added. No one got back to me on the day of the meeting at all. No emails, no missed calls, nothing. I had to chase them and it took me a couple of days to actually find out that it had all gone through without any issues. So panicked for nothing. Communication isn’t always their strong point.
Keep chasing them up.
